With eight years of dedicated experience teaching 11th-grade mathematics, I have developed a deep expertise in navigating the critical transition from foundational geometry to advanced algebraic reasoning. My tenure has been defined by: Curriculum Mastery: Delivering comprehensive instruction in Trigonometry, Pre-Calculus, and Complex Numbers, ensuring students meet and exceed state/national standards. Student Mentorship: Recognizing 11th grade as a 'pressure point' year, I implement differentiated instruction to support both struggling learners and high-achievers aiming for competitive university placements. Pedagogical Innovation: Integrating digital tools like Desmos and GeoGebra to transform abstract functions into visual, interactive models that stick. Results-Oriented Teaching: Consistently maintaining a high pass rate and improving standardized test scores through rigorous mock assessments and targeted feedback loops.

Expert Mastery of the "Transition Gap" The jump from 10th-grade Math to 11th-grade is the steepest in the school system. My 8 years of experience have focused on: Demystifying Abstraction: Moving students from simple geometry to Coordinate Geometry and from basic arithmetic to Sets, Relations, and Functions. Calculus Foundations: Introducing the concepts of Limits and Derivatives—often the most intimidating topics—using intuitive logic before diving into formal proofs. Trigonometric Rigor: Transforming trigonometry from "triangle math" into a language of periodic functions and identities, ensuring students can derive formulas rather than just memorizing them.
